The technology
In nature, hair-like cilia create flow in and on organisms — including your own airways. We mirror that principle with Magnetic Artificial Cilia (MAC): microscopic actuators integrated into a standard well plate. Powered by MACnet, they generate controlled fluid flow inside MACplate.
